Morten E. Gill


Morten E. Gill, 87, of Springfield passed away Sunday, April 27, 2008 in the Springfield Regional Medical Center High Street Campus.

He was born in Lewis County, Kentucky on November 8, 1920, the son of Archie B. and Janie C. (Mason) Gill.

Morten was a machinist working 30 years for Atlas Gear in Pitchin and retiring from the Lord Corporation with 10 years of service. He attended the New Apostolic Church and he loved working with his hands, especially woodworking.

Morten was preceded in death by his parents; two brothers Everett and Floyd Gill; and niece Patsy Bradford.

His survivors include his wife Clarice A. (Brown) Gill, whom he married August 31, 1957; one daughter Loretta Huffman of Springfield; five sons Michael & Linda Gill, David & Alma Gill, and William J. & Donna Walk all of Springfield, Marion & Sherrie Gill of Buford, SC, and Christopher & Becky Gill of Enon; one sister Goldie Cox of Xenia; 17 grandchildren, 21 great-grandchildren, several nieces and nephews.

The family wishes to thank the nurses on the Progressive Care floor at the High St. Campus of the Springfield Regional Medical Center for their outstanding care.

Visitation will be Friday from 6-8 PM in the RICHARDS, RAFF & DUNBAR MEMORIAL HOME, where services will be Saturday at 10:30 AM with Rev. Mark Jousf officiating.
